What this Trial Is About

This study will recruit 100 patients with ulcerative colitis in remission for a 6-month non intervention follow-up observation. During the study, their conditions will be recorded truthfully, including general information, disease-related symptoms and signs, inflammatory bowel disease questionnaire, anxiety self-assessment scale, depression self-assessment scale, etc., every month. Collect blood, urine, and stool samples from patients every month for examination. Follow up for each subject until their condition recurs.

Eligibility Criteria

Eligible

You may qualify if you...

  • Diagnosed with ulcerative colitis based on clinical symptoms, imaging, endoscopy, laboratory, and histopathological exams
  • Meet clinical characteristics of ulcerative colitis in the "remission recurrence" critical state
  • Have comprehensive laboratory testing indicators
Not Eligible

You will not qualify if you...

  • Incomplete case information records
  • Incomplete serological test results
  • Complications such as intestinal obstruction, intestinal perforation, toxic megacolon, or severe local stenosis
  • Diagnosed or suspected uncertain colitis, infectious colitis, or ischemic colitis
  • Coexisting local or systemic infections, malignant diseases, or autoimmune diseases
  • Primary diseases like respiratory, circulatory, neurological, endocrine, or hematological disorders
  • At risk of developing cancer
  • Pregnant or lactating women
